Leongatha

Leongatha is a large town of around 5,000 located amongst green rolling hills, 133km south-east of Melbourne at the junction of South Gippsland Highway (A440) abd Bass and Strzlecki Highways (B460). It is the largest town in the South Gippsland region. The Murray-Goulburn Dairy in Leongatha is the largest cooperative in the southern hemisphere. The town hosts a Food and Wine Festival every January. The town centre is quite large, spread along two main streets.
